Did you know Galadriel’s gift to Aragorn is very different in Tolkien’s The Lord of the Rings: The Fellowship of the Ring?
In Peter Jackson’s film, when it is Aragorn’s turn to receive a gift, Galadriel looks at the necklace he carries from Arwen and tells him that she has nothing greater to give him than the gift he already bears: Arwen’s love.
She then speaks of Arwen’s choice to give up her immortality and remain in Middle-earth for Aragorn. Galadriel fears that by choosing a mortal life and the fate of Men, Arwen will gradually lose the grace and beauty of the Elves.
Aragorn responds by saying that he wishes Arwen would leave these shores and sail to Valinor, where she could remain with her own people. It’s a brief but meaningful exchange that highlights the sacrifice behind Arwen’s choice.
But in Tolkien’s book, this moment is completely different. Instead of speaking about Arwen’s necklace, Galadriel gives Aragorn the Elessar, the Elfstone, a great green stone set in a silver brooch shaped like an eagle. She explains that she had given it to her daughter Celebrían, who later passed it to Arwen, and now it comes to Aragorn as a token of hope.
